Definition

Gâteaux differentiability refers to a generalization of the concept of differentiation for functions between Banach spaces, where the derivative is defined in terms of directional derivatives. This concept is essential for understanding how functions behave in a variety of mathematical contexts, especially when dealing with multifunctions and their continuity and differentiability properties. It provides a framework for analyzing how functions change as you move in different directions within their domain.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Gâteaux differentiability is defined at a point by the existence of a limit of the difference quotient as you approach that point along a specific direction.
  2. Unlike Fréchet differentiability, Gâteaux differentiability does not require the derivative to be linear or continuous across all directions.
  3. If a function is Gâteaux differentiable at every point in its domain, it does not necessarily imply that the function is continuous everywhere.
  4. This concept is particularly useful in optimization problems, where finding optimal solutions often involves examining directional derivatives.
  5. Gâteaux differentiability can be used to study properties of multifunctions, which are mappings from one set to multiple outputs.

Review Questions

  • How does Gâteaux differentiability relate to directional derivatives, and why is this relationship significant?
    • Gâteaux differentiability is fundamentally based on the idea of directional derivatives, where it specifically looks at how a function changes as you move in a certain direction from a point. This relationship is significant because it allows us to understand local behavior without needing the stricter conditions imposed by Fréchet differentiability. In optimization and analysis, this flexibility makes it easier to explore potential solutions and examine function behavior in various directions.
